Output 5455a9380903dc4f6cd6c2c24b31617fb59b4c19a19072fd4b9def51416a3f62:3

value
24531845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0940f8db40ff98a9575fde51f67c3aad00b3573 OP_EQUAL
address
3HngDkK8BPv5X4kReA492QUvx1oRVKjsuw
transaction
5455a9380903dc4f6cd6c2c24b31617fb59b4c19a19072fd4b9def51416a3f62
spent
true